Why Digitizing Your Vinyl Matters in 2026

The Preservation Imperative

Vinyl records are physical objects locked in a slow-motion battle with entropy. Each playback wears the grooves imperceptibly, while environmental factors like temperature fluctuations, humidity, and even gravity work silently to warp and degrade your collection. Digitization creates a perfect snapshot of your record’s current state—flaws and all—that can be reproduced infinitely without further wear. In 2026, with cloud storage costs at historic lows and lossless streaming becoming the norm, there’s no excuse not to create digital backups.

Understanding USB Turntable Technology

The Analog-to-Digital Bridge

At its core, a USB turntable is a traditional turntable with a critical addition: an onboard analog-to-digital converter (ADC). This tiny chip performs the alchemical transformation of continuous analog waveforms into discrete digital samples. The quality of this conversion—determined by the ADC’s clock stability, bit depth, and circuit isolation—separates archival-grade tables from toy-store novelties. In 2026, premium models feature asynchronous USB clocks that divorce the turntable’s timing from your computer’s noisy internal clock, drastically reducing jitter.

Signal Path Architecture

The journey from groove to file matters immensely. Budget models often place the ADC chip near the motor, picking up electromagnetic interference that manifests as a subtle haze over your recordings. Superior designs isolate the ADC in its own shielded chamber, sometimes even using optical isolation to break ground loops. Understanding this architecture helps you spot specs that matter: signal-to-noise ratios above 85dB, channel separation beyond 55dB, and THD (Total Harmonic Distortion) below 0.05% indicate thoughtful engineering.

Key Features That Define Quality Digitization

ADC Quality and Specifications

The heart of any USB turntable is its analog-to-digital converter. In 2026, entry-level models typically use 16-bit/48kHz converters—adequate for casual listening but insufficient for archival work. Serious digitization demands 24-bit/96kHz minimum, with premium tables offering 32-bit float recording at 192kHz. The bit depth determines dynamic range capture, while sample rate dictates the highest reproducible frequency. For vinyl, which rarely contains meaningful information above 25kHz, 96kHz sampling provides generous headroom without creating unwieldy file sizes.

RIAA Equalization: Built-in vs. Software

All vinyl records are mastered with RIAA equalization, boosting highs and cutting lows to save groove space. Your turntable must apply inverse RIAA equalization during playback. Some USB models apply this in hardware before conversion; others output the “raw” RIAA curve for software correction. Hardware equalization offers convenience, but software solutions (like those in Audacity or specialized vinyl restoration programs) often provide more transparent results and allow you to preserve the raw signal for future processing improvements.

Cartridge and Stylus Considerations

Moving Magnet vs. Moving Coil for Digitization

Moving Magnet (MM) cartridges dominate the USB turntable market for good reason: they output higher voltage, work with standard phono inputs, and feature user-replaceable styli. For digitization, MM cartridges offer excellent value and simplicity. Moving Coil (MC) designs, while prized by audiophiles for their detail retrieval, present challenges: their low output requires sophisticated preamplification, and few USB tables include adequate MC stages. Unless your table offers MC compatibility with adjustable gain, stick with a high-quality MM cartridge.

Stylus Profiles and Groove Contact

The stylus tip shape dramatically affects what information gets extracted. Conical tips make minimal groove contact, potentially skating over fine details. Elliptical tips dig deeper, capturing more high-frequency information and reducing inner-groove distortion. For archival work, consider line-contact or micro-ridge styli—they contact the groove walls across a vertical span nearly identical to the original cutting stylus, retrieving information that lesser tips miss. Just ensure your table’s tonearm can handle the required tracking force (typically 1.5-2.0g for advanced profiles).

Drive Systems: Belt vs. Direct Drive

Speed Stability for Digital Capture

Digitization ruthlessly exposes speed inconsistencies. A turntable with poor speed stability produces files with wavering pitch that’s impossible to correct later. Modern belt-drive tables use precision-ground platters and electronically regulated motors to achieve wow and flutter below 0.15%—acceptable for most listeners. Direct-drive systems, with their quartz-locked motors, often achieve <0.10% and maintain speed under varying stylus drag. For critical digitization, direct drive’s superior torque and stability edge out belt drive, though a well-engineered belt table remains perfectly capable.

Vibration and Noise Characteristics

Belt drives isolate motor vibration through the elastic belt, potentially offering quieter backgrounds. Direct drives couple motor vibration directly to the platter but use sophisticated damping to mitigate noise. In practice, a table’s overall design matters more than drive type. Look for models with heavy platters (mass damps vibration) and motors mounted on isolation sub-chassis rather than directly to the plinth.

Preamp Built-in vs. External Options

The Flexibility Factor

USB turntables with switchable built-in preamps offer the best of both worlds. Engage the internal preamp for direct connection to powered speakers or simple digitization setups. Bypass it to use an external phono stage that might outperform the onboard unit, then feed that signal into the USB ADC. This flexibility proves invaluable as your system grows. Bypass Quality and Transparency

Not all preamp bypasses are created equal. Cheap designs merely switch the preamp out of circuit but leave its components connected, potentially loading the cartridge and degrading sound. Premium tables use relay-based true bypass that completely removes the preamp from the signal path. Check reviews for measurements of bypassed vs. engaged frequency response—anything more than ±0.5dB deviation suggests compromised design.

Software and Digital Workflow

Bundled Software vs. Professional Solutions

Most USB turntables include basic recording software, often cut-down versions of programs like Audacity or proprietary apps. These suffice for simple captures but lack advanced features like click/pop removal, track splitting algorithms, and metadata tagging. Professional workflows might combine Audacity (for recording) with iZotope RX (for restoration) and dBpoweramp (for encoding and tagging). The key is ensuring your turntable’s USB output is recognized as a standard audio device, giving you software freedom.

Sample Rate and Bit Depth Explained

The Nyquist-Shannon Reality Check

Digital audio theory states you need a sample rate at least twice the highest frequency you want to capture. Vinyl rarely contains useful information above 25kHz, suggesting 50kHz sampling would suffice. However, real-world filters aren’t perfect; sampling at 96kHz pushes the anti-aliasing filter’s artifacts well beyond the audible range, resulting in cleaner sound. For archival, 96kHz/24-bit represents the sweet spot of quality and practicality. Higher rates create massive files with diminishing returns.

Oversampling and Delta-Sigma ADCs

Most modern ADCs are delta-sigma designs that oversample at MHz rates before decimating to your chosen output rate. This process shapes quantization noise above the audible band. The quality of this oversampling and noise-shaping algorithm separates good converters from great ones. Specs like “dynamic range” and “THD+N” give clues, but listening tests remain crucial. Record a silent groove and listen to the noise floor—good converters produce hiss; poor ones produce hiss with subtle digital hash.

Connectivity Options Beyond USB

Monitoring While Recording

Digitization requires real-time monitoring to catch problems like mistracking or surface noise. USB turntables with analog outputs let you listen through a stereo system while recording via USB—a crucial feature. Some cheaper models mute analog outputs during USB operation, forcing you to monitor through computer speakers with their inherent latency. Look for models with direct analog pass-through that remains active regardless of USB status.

Build Quality and Vibration Control

Plinth Materials and Resonance Control

The plinth (base) is the foundation of everything. MDF remains common, offering good damping at moderate cost. High-density acrylic provides superior isolation but adds expense. Some premium tables use constrained-layer damping—sandwiching materials with different resonant frequencies to cancel vibrations. For digitization, a heavy, non-resonant plinth prevents environmental vibrations (footfalls, HVAC, traffic) from modulating the stylus and creating unfixable artifacts in your recordings.

Platter Mass and Stability

A heavy platter acts as a flywheel, resisting speed variations and damping vibrations. Platters weighing 2-3kg are typical for serious tables; some exceed 5kg. Material matters too: aluminum offers good mass and machining precision, while acrylic provides self-damping properties. Glass platters, popular in the 2010s, have fallen out of favor due to resonance issues. For digitization, mass is your friend—heavier almost always means more stable, more consistent transfers.

Speed Accuracy and Wow & Flutter

Measuring the Immeasurable

Wow and flutter specifications quantify speed variations, but the numbers don’t tell the full story. A table might achieve 0.08% flutter yet exhibit cyclical speed variations that create audible pitch waver. Modern measurement tools like the PlatterSpeed app use your phone’s sensors to generate detailed speed graphs, revealing periodic errors that specs hide. For digitization, consistency trumps absolute accuracy—a table that runs consistently 0.5% fast can be corrected in software; one that constantly hunts for correct speed cannot.

Quartz Lock and Servo Systems

Direct-drive tables use quartz-locked motors that compare actual speed to a reference crystal, making continuous micro-adjustments. The best implementations update hundreds of times per second, reacting to stylus drag and voltage fluctuations. Belt-drive tables increasingly use optical sensors on the platter rim with servo-controlled motors, achieving similar stability. When evaluating specs, look for weighted peak flutter (DIN 45507) rather than unweighted RMS figures—the former better correlates with audible performance.

Automatic vs. Manual Operation

The Convenience vs. Quality Trade-off

Fully automatic turntables, with their mechanism-laden tonearms, add mass and resonance that can subtly degrade sound. For digitizing a thousand records, however, the convenience of automatic operation might outweigh minor sonic compromises. Manual tables demand you lift and cue the tonearm for each side, but offer purist performance. Budget Tiers: What to Expect

Entry-Level Realities (Under $300)

Budget USB turntables prioritize convenience over absolute fidelity. Expect integrated non-replaceable cartridges, basic 16-bit/48kHz ADCs, and lightweight construction. They’re perfectly adequate for digitizing spoken word, heavily worn records, or casual listening copies. Don’t expect archival quality, but do expect a functional introduction to digitization. The real cost? Time spent fighting with unstable software and re-recording glitchy files.

Mid-Range Sweet Spot ($300-$800)

This is where serious digitization begins. You’ll find replaceable cartridges, 24-bit/96kHz ADCs with asynchronous USB, adjustable tonearms, and substantial platters. Build quality jumps significantly, with better isolation and more accurate speed control. Most users will find a table in this range provides 90% of the performance of cost-no-object designs. The key differentiators become cartridge quality and software bundle sophistication.

Troubleshooting Common Digitization Issues

The Dreaded Ground Loop Hum

That 60Hz (or 50Hz) hum ruining your transfers is almost always a ground loop—multiple paths to ground creating a voltage differential. USB turntables are notorious for this because they connect to both your stereo system (grounded) and computer (grounded through the power supply). Solutions include: using a USB isolator (a $30 device that breaks the ground connection), connecting both devices to the same power strip, or using the turntable’s analog outputs into an external ADC with proper isolation.

USB Dropouts and Buffer Issues

Digital audio streams require consistent data flow. When your computer’s CPU spikes, the USB buffer can empty, creating audible glitches. Prevent this by: using ASIO or Core Audio drivers (not generic Windows drivers), increasing buffer size in your recording software (at the cost of monitoring latency), closing all unnecessary applications, and disabling Wi-Fi during recording. Some 2026 turntables include onboard memory buffers that store a few seconds of audio, smoothing over brief computer hiccups.

Maintaining Your USB Turntable

Stylus Care: The First Line of Defense

A dirty stylus destroys records and corrupts digitizations. Clean it before every session with a carbon fiber brush or stylus cleaning solution. Inspect under magnification monthly for wear or bent cantilevers. Replace after 500-1000 hours of play—less if you’re digitizing dirty or worn records. A worn stylus will produce files with distorted highs and smeared transistors that no software can fix.

Periodic Calibration and Software Updates

Check speed accuracy quarterly using a test record and strobe disc. Clean the belt and pulley (if applicable) with isopropyl alcohol. Tighten mounting screws, as vibration loosens them over time. Future-Proofing Your Vinyl Digitization Setup

Modular Component Strategy

The most future-proof approach treats the USB turntable as separable components: a quality turntable, a quality tonearm, and a quality ADC. Many enthusiasts start with an integrated USB table, then upgrade to an external ADC as their needs grow. Ensure your table’s USB output can be disabled, allowing you to feed analog signals to future, better converters. This modular path spreads cost and lets you upgrade incrementally.

Archival Format Considerations

Record at 24-bit/96kHz and save as uncompressed WAV or lossless FLAC. Store these as your “masters,” then create MP3 or AAC copies for portable use. Keep multiple backups: one local on an SSD, one on a NAS or cloud service, and one off-site. What’s the best file format for archiving vinyl digitally?

For masters, use 24-bit/96kHz FLAC. FLAC provides perfect bit-for-bit lossless compression, cutting file sizes by 30-50% with zero quality loss. WAV works but wastes storage space. Avoid any lossy format (MP3, AAC) for archival—they discard information permanently. Create lossy copies from your FLAC masters for portable devices, but preserve the originals. How long does it take to digitize a typical record collection?

Expect a 1:1 ratio for recording—45 minutes of vinyl takes 45 minutes to capture. Add 15-30 minutes per album for editing, track splitting, metadata entry, and encoding. A 300-record collection (roughly 450 sides) demands 340-500 hours of active work. Semi-automated software can cut this by 30%, but quality control still requires human ears. Plan your workflow: digitize in batches, processing files while recording others, to maximize efficiency.

Will digitizing my vinyl damage the records?

Properly digitized vinyl suffers no more wear than normal playback. In fact, since you’ll likely play the record only once during digitization, then listen to the digital copy, you dramatically reduce lifetime wear. The key is proper setup: correct tracking force, clean stylus, and dust-free records. A misaligned or worn stylus will cause damage regardless of whether you’re recording. Some archivists argue that the slightly higher tracking force needed for optimal digitization (2.0g vs. 1.5g) causes marginally more wear, but the difference is negligible for a single play.

Can I edit out pops and clicks without losing audio quality?

Yes, but with caveats. Automated declicking algorithms work by detecting transient spikes and interpolating the missing waveform. Light crackle removal is largely transparent, but heavy clicks can leave artifacts if the algorithm guesses wrong. The key is working from a high-resolution source (24-bit/96kHz) and using surgical tools manually for loud pops. Always preserve the original unedited file. How do I handle 78rpm records on a modern USB turntable?

Most USB turntables lack 78rpm speed, but workarounds exist. Some 2026 models include 78rpm with interchangeable styli—78s require a 3.0-3.5 mil stylus, not the 0.7 mil used for microgroove LPs. Without 78rpm speed, record at 45rpm and use software to pitch-shift (speed up) the file by 73.3%. This works but reduces quality slightly. Better: use a variable-speed turntable that reaches 78rpm, or invest in a separate 78rpm deck feeding an external ADC. Always use the correct stylus—playing a 78 with an LP stylus damages both record and stylus.

What’s the difference between USB 2.0 and USB-C turntables?

USB 2.0 provides 480Mbps bandwidth—massive overkill for audio, which needs less than 10Mbps even for 32-bit/192kHz stereo. The real difference isn’t speed but power delivery and connector durability. USB-C handles more current, enabling turntables with more sophisticated onboard processing without external power supplies. The connector is also reversible and more robust. Sonically, there’s no inherent difference. Focus on the ADC quality and driver support rather than USB version. Some USB-C tables include Thunderbolt compatibility, but this offers no audio benefit.

Should I digitize at the highest possible sample rate?

Not necessarily. Recording at 192kHz creates files four times larger than 48kHz recordings with no audible benefit—vinyl simply doesn’t contain information at those frequencies. Worse, some ADCs perform worse at extreme rates due to increased clock jitter. The 2026 consensus: 96kHz provides perfect capture with headroom for any ultrasonic content (like tape bias artifacts) while keeping file sizes manageable. Record at 24-bit depth to provide digital headroom during editing, but sample rates beyond 96kHz are for bragging rights, not better sound.
